Ethical Considerations in AI Art
As the use of AI in art continues to grow, there are several ethical considerations that need to be addressed. While AI can produce impressive and innovative artwork, we must also be mindful of its potential ethical implications.
1. Ownership and Attribution
One of the key ethical concerns in AI art is the issue of ownership and attribution. When AI is used to create artwork, determining who owns the copyright and should be credited as the artist can become complicated. AI algorithms may be trained on existing works, which raises questions about originality and plagiarism. Clear guidelines and regulations need to be established to address these challenges.
2. Bias and Discrimination
AI algorithms are only as unbiased as the data they are trained on. If the training data contains biases or discriminatory patterns, the AI artwork produced may also reflect these biases. It is crucial to ensure that the training data is diverse and representative of all communities to prevent the reinforcement of existing social inequalities and biases through AI art.
3. Manipulation and Misuse
AI art can be used for nefarious purposes, such as creating deepfakes or generating misleading content. This raises concerns about the potential for manipulation and misuse. Policies and safeguards should be put in place to prevent the misuse of AI-generated art and protect against its harmful effects.
4. Transparency and Explainability
AI algorithms used in art creation can be highly complex, making it difficult to understand the decision-making process. The lack of transparency and explainability can raise concerns about accountability and trust. Artists and developers using AI in art should strive to make the process more transparent and provide explanations for how the algorithm produces its output.

Natural Language Processing in Art Analysis
Artificial Intelligence (AI) has revolutionized various industries, including art. AI models and algorithms have been developed to analyze and evaluate artworks, providing unbiased reviews and feedback. One critical aspect of this analysis is Natural Language Processing (NLP).
NLP is a branch of AI that focuses on the interaction between computers and human language. It enables computers to understand, interpret, and generate human language, including written text. In the context of art analysis, NLP algorithms are designed to analyze text-based reviews, critiques, and descriptions of artworks.
1. Text Analysis
NLP algorithms can automatically extract key information from art reviews, such as the artist’s name, art genre, and artistic techniques used. They can identify and categorize sentiments expressed in reviews, distinguishing between positive and negative feedback.
By analyzing text, NLP algorithms can also extract valuable insights about the context and artistic intent behind an artwork. For example, they can uncover historical references, cultural influences, and underlying themes explored in the artwork.
2. Sentiment Analysis
Sentiment analysis plays a crucial role in art AI reviews. NLP algorithms can accurately determine the emotions conveyed in art reviews, providing unbiased sentiment scores. This information helps art enthusiasts and buyers understand the overall reception and emotional impact of an artwork.
Sentiment analysis can also analyze the sentiment of individual components of an artwork, such as specific colors, shapes, or textures. This analysis provides a deeper understanding of how different artistic elements contribute to the overall emotional experience.

Computer Vision Techniques for Art Recognition
In the field of artificial intelligence (AI), computer vision techniques play a crucial role in art recognition. With the advancements in AI, computer vision algorithms have become powerful tools for identifying and analyzing different forms of art. These techniques enable AI systems to understand and interpret visual content, which can be particularly useful in art reviews.
1. Object Detection
One of the fundamental computer vision techniques used in art recognition is object detection. This technique allows AI systems to identify and locate specific objects within an image or artwork. By training AI models on large datasets of labeled art images, computer vision algorithms can learn to recognize and classify different objects, such as people, animals, buildings, and various objects commonly found in artworks.
2. Style Analysis
Another important aspect of art recognition is style analysis. Computer vision techniques can be employed to analyze and identify the artistic style or genre of a particular artwork. By examining visual features such as colors, brushstrokes, and compositional elements, AI systems can learn to categorize artworks into different styles, such as impressionism, cubism, or surrealism. This information can provide valuable insights for art reviews, allowing critics to evaluate an artist’s style or compare artworks from different periods.

AI and Art Authentication
Art authentication is a crucial process that determines the authenticity of a piece of art. With the increasing number of art forgeries in the market, the need for a reliable authentication system has become essential. Here, AI plays a significant role in ensuring the integrity of art authentication.
AI-powered algorithms use advanced image recognition techniques to analyze and compare artworks. These algorithms can identify unique patterns, styles, and techniques used by artists to create their masterpieces. By comparing these patterns with known authentic artworks, AI can provide valuable insights into the authenticity of a piece.
Reviews of AI in art authentication have shown promising results. AI algorithms have been able to detect forgeries that were previously considered authentic by human experts. These algorithms can identify subtle differences in brushstrokes, composition, and color palettes that the human eye may miss. This has led to the discovery of many valuable forgeries that were deceiving the art market.
Furthermore, AI algorithms also have the ability to analyze historical and contextual information about an artwork. They can gather data such as the artist’s biography, exhibition history, and previous sale records. This information can help in determining the provenance and authenticity of a piece.
However, it is important to note that AI should not replace human expertise in art authentication. It should be used as a tool to assist and enhance the capabilities of human experts. Human art historians and conservators still play a crucial role in evaluating the overall quality and historical significance of a piece.
